Cleghorn Plumbing & Heating Inc
Description
142 Clarendon St, Fitchburg 01420-4006, USA
Recommended For You
Heating & Cooling • 420 views
Add Favorites
505 Narragansett Park Drive Pawtucket, RI 02861
Scan QR code to view on mobile device.
Heating & Cooling • 271 views
Add Favorites
216 Water St, Fitchburg 01420-5433, USA
Scan QR code to view on mobile device.
Heating & Cooling • 302 views
Add Favorites
824 Partridgeville Road, Athol 1331, USA
Scan QR code to view on mobile device.